Checklist Comments:    DOS Sea Watch Field Trip
clear to partly cloudy
Temp: 47-59 F
Wind SW @ 5-10 mph
30 species

Harlequin Duck  4    Male and 3 female feeding at the tip of the south jetty. Sea ducks that were smaller than scoters. Females had 3 spots on face and male had a big white crescent behind bill. Last seen flying south towards Bethany.
